Removing Salt
If too much salt has been added, a buzzer will sound for an hour and the
right side red LED on the control panel will light up (see “Alarm Handling”).
The water in the saltwater tank must be replaced as follows:
1.
Check local regulations for specific directions regarding disposal of
swimming pool water. Note that salt water can damage grass, plants,
etc.
2.
Open the tank cover
(3)
. See Fig. 12.
3.
Check to make sure that the drain
valve plug
(10)
inside the saltwater
tank is plugged in place. See Fig. 13.
4.
Remove the drain valve cap
(11)
from
the drain valve on the outside saltwater
tank wall.

IMPORTANT
Close plunger valves or insert black hat-like plugs in strainer opening to
prevent water spillage. Open plunger valves or remove plugs when
maintenance is completed.
